Abstract

This research aims to: (1) Find out whether there is an effect parental education level on learning achievement of XI grade students of SMA Negeri 1 Banggai, (2) find out whether there is an effect of learning motivation on learning achievement in XI grade mathematics at SMA Negeri 1 Banggai, (3) find out whether there is an effect of parents education level and learning motivation on learning achievement of XI grade mathematics subjects at SMA Negeri 1 Banggai. This research is a quantitative research using associative analysis technique with the research subjects being 56 student of class XI science. Data collection techniques using questionnaires and documentation. Research results show that (1) there is an effect of the variable level of parental education (X1) on the learning achievement of XI grade students in mathematics at SMA Negeri 1 Banggai, evidenced by the results of the partial test t arithmetic = 6,029 > t table 1,674 with a significant 0,000 < 0,05 which means H0 is rejected and Ha is accepted, (2) there is no influence of learning motivation variable on learning achievement of XI grade mathematic subjects at SMA Negeri 1 Banggai, evidenced by the results of the partial test t arithmetic = 1,457 < t table 1,673 with a significant 0,151 < 0,05 which means H0 is accepted and Ha is rejected, (3) there is a simultaneous influence of parents education level and learning motivation on learning achievement in mathematics for XI grade students of SMA Negeri 1 Banggai, evidenced by the results of the simultaneous test F count = 18,996 > F table 3,17 with a significant 0,000 < 0,05 so the H0 is rejected and Ha is accepted. The influence of parents education level on learning achievement is 39,68% greater than the influence of learning motivation on learning achievement which is 2,06%. The effect of parents education level and learning motivation simultaneously on learning achievement is 41,8% and the remaining 58,2% is influenced by other reasons not included in this study.
